Predictors of selective laser trabeculoplasty success in open angle glaucoma or ocular hypertension: does baseline tonography have a predictive role?

Volume: 104, Issue: 10, Pages: 1390 - 1393
Published: Jan 27, 2020
Abstract
The determinants of success of selective laser trabeculoplasty (SLT) in treatment-naïve patients with open angle glaucoma (OAG) and ocular hypertension (OHT) have not been understood fully. Therefore, we have conducted this study to explore the predictors of success.This is a retrospective review of a pre-existing database of patients who had received primary SLT at St Thomas' Hospital, London, UK.
